Why is it so important to be sure that the electrode pads are firmly adhered to a clean, dry chest?

0

Successful defibrillation requires electricity to flow from one electrode pad to the other through the chest. If the electrode pads are not firmly adhered and there is sweat or another conductive material between the electrode pads, the electricity will be more likely to flow across the chest rather than through it. This will result in ineffective defibrillation and an increased chance of sparks and fire.
